What to do before filing

Send a demand letter first, set a clear deadline, and keep proof of delivery in case you need to file.

Gather Your Documentation

Collect all contracts, receipts, correspondence, photos, and other evidence before filing. Strong documentation significantly improves your chances of success.

Understand Deadlines

New Mexico has specific statutes of limitations for different claim types. Security deposits, unpaid wages, and contract disputes each have different time limits.
